摘要
汽车轻量化是实现节能减排的重要措施之一,对汽车工业的可持续发展具有重要意义。本文从结构优化设计、轻量化材料的应用和先进制造工艺这三个方面对汽车轻量化技术的国内外研究现状和发展趋势进行了综述。这包括:汽车结构的尺寸优化、形状优化、拓扑优化和多学科设计优化的基本原理和研究进展;高强度钢、铝合金、镁合金、塑料和复合材料;以及液压成型和激光焊接工艺在汽车中的使用现状。作者认为:汽车轻量化技术的未来研究方向是:汽车结构优化设计理论的完善、多材料一体化、零部件的轻量化和轻量化技术的系统化与集成化。
